Bordeaux producer Darius has released a remix of MØ's track 'Don't Wanna Dance' and it's just as good as you'd expect.

Danish songstress   really knows how to get you on the dance floor with her range of upbeat electronic tracks.

The artist has become one of Denmark's best exports with her sweet voice and upbeat melodies, dubbed "the new GRIMES" quite early on in her career,   really surprised us all when she steered clear of the GRIMES influence to produce tracks that were a lot shinier and more fun to groove to.

  released her track 'Don't Wanna Dance' quite some time ago and despite its title, the track is smooth and easy to move to. The track is carried by her wonderful vocals with deep percussion providing a solid platform for her to shine. A new remix has emerged for 'Don't Wanna Dance' by Bordeaux-based producer DARIUS and it's got a sweet funk that you only hear from specific artists these days.

DARIUS has opened his remix with a very smooth synth being covered with  's cooing vocals until a very digital groove kicks in. DARIUS' remix is velvety smooth, quite different from the original 'Don't Wanna Dance' mix. With early 2000's house making an appearance, the remix pushes on with beaming synths that burst through the track with the vocal track sounding ghostly as it echoes between the melody. The pace has been slowed down quite a lot to develop a tempo that just plods along in its own time, making the remix feel more relaxed and cool.

With this new remix, DARIUS has shown how he can take one track that sounds very energetic and turn it down into a velveteen dream that flows with ease.  's original track broke her out from the "new GRIMES" label and into her own, now DARIUS seems to have a grand introduction to us by creating a very sweet track that we now can't get enough of.
